Product Description

by Miriam Sobre-Denton (Contribution by), Bree McEwan (Author)

This book examines societal changes due to the increased use of communication technology. Topics include identity, privacy, communication competence, online communities, online social support, mediated relational maintenance, and mobile communication. It is ideal for graduate students and scholars in sociology, psychology, and communication.

Author Biography

Bree McEwan is associate professor in the Department of Communication at Western Illinois University
